I love prediction time....

 

'The right' have their best chance in Austria (election early December), and with Geert Wilders in Holland next year. Both have said they will hold EU exit referenda, if they win - but even coming a good second will increase the pressure in both countries.

 

In France, Marine le Pen will be beaten by coalition's and tactical voting, but will also strengthen her position, and force the French government to re-examine the future of the EU, especially it's policies on immigration.

 

Similar in Germany, too, I reckon. Merkel should hold on, but her power base will be greatly eroded by AfD.

 

The Greek, Italian, Spanish and Portuguese economies are still tethering on the brink, and the wider EU economy will have even larger holes to plug, once we leave.

 

On the whole, the future does not look bright for the EU - the house of cards is tottering, and only major policy changes will prevent it's complete collapse !
